Why Thermal Fuse for Speed Queen Dryer Is Necessary
I’ve found that the thermal fuse is one of the most important safety parts in a Speed Queen dryer. My dryer depends on it to protect the machine from overheating, and without it, the dryer could keep running at unsafe temperatures. That can damage internal parts and even create a fire risk, so the thermal fuse acts like a final safety guard.
I also like that it helps me avoid bigger repair problems. If airflow is blocked, vents are clogged, or another part starts failing, the thermal fuse can shut the dryer down before serious damage happens. In my experience, that small part can save me from expensive repairs and keep the dryer working safely for a longer time.
For me, the thermal fuse is necessary because it protects both my home and my appliance. It gives me peace of mind knowing the dryer has a built-in backup that stops overheating before it becomes dangerous.

Signs I Need a Replacement
If my dryer is not heating, stops mid-cycle, or seems completely dead, I consider the thermal fuse as a possible cause. I do not replace it blindly, but I know these symptoms often point to a safety shutdown. I also check for dust buildup, blocked vents, or overheating issues that may have caused the fuse to fail.

Installation Tips I Follow
When I replace a thermal fuse, I always unplug the dryer first. I take photos before removing any wires so I can reconnect everything correctly. I also clean the lint filter and vent system while I’m at it, because poor airflow can cause the same problem again.
